Output 07cad9c73c72d5ab0fef08a4496b8f17f3d2b602846d62d912cfed5040ef00cc:80

value
138635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 799bdf1f3d4c6b4f3fe8ea907b460eb802395e95 OP_EQUAL
address
3Cn2QuFxCVT7a1gAwQLobGSQtLBXVVwGU9
transaction
07cad9c73c72d5ab0fef08a4496b8f17f3d2b602846d62d912cfed5040ef00cc
spent
true